Three members of the Jutebag team are undertaking an epic journey by tuk tuk to support the expansion of a pioneering Indian school.
Amit Shah, Mayur Patel and Ketan Chag are participating in the ‘Tuk Tuk Safarnama’, travelling 3,000km in one of the iconic vehicles from the shores of Rameshwaram, traversing India and ending in the city of Bhuj, where the school is based.

All money raised will go to the charity Sishukunj, which aims to build a teacher training centre at the school, along with vocational training facilities and hostel units for 100 girls and boys.
Jutebag has already donated £2,000 on its own account to the cause, in place of sending out the customary seasonal gifts.
The school project is being delivered through Sishukunji’s Sewa division. Sewa is dedicated to alleviating poverty, distress and illness amongst children and young adults.
It provides essentials such as food, shelter and health care, collaborating with carefully vetted partner charities primarily in India, East Africa and here in the UK.
